Comprehending Integrated Ovens
An integrated oven is developed to sit flush with kitchen cabinetry, offering a constant, sleek appearance that matches contemporary kitchen styles. Unlike conventional freestanding ovens, integrated ovens are built into the kitchen units, making them less conspicuous and more visually appealing.

Types of Integrated Ovens
Integrated ovens can be found in numerous styles and functionalities, catering to different cooking requirements and preferences. The primary types consist of:
TypeDescriptionSingle OvensRequirement ovens created for simple baking, roasting, and grilling.Double Ovens2 oven compartments, permitting for simultaneous cooking at various temperatures.Combination OvensIncorporates several cooking techniques, such as convection and microwave.Steam OvensMake use of steam for cooking, ideal for well balanced meals and maintained nutrients.Wall OvensBuilt into the wall, freeing up counter area and permitting a more ergonomic style.Key Features to Consider
When picking an integrated oven, a number of crucial features ought to be taken into account:
Size and Capacity
Guarantee the oven fits the designated space and meets your cooking needs. Typical sizes include 24, 27, and 30 inches.
Cooking Functions
Search for versatile cooking functions such as baking, broiling, roasting, and steam cooking.
Energy Efficiency
Opt for designs with high energy ratings to save money on utility costs and lower ecological impact.
Smart Technology
Functions such as Wi-Fi connection, remote monitoring, and programmable settings can enhance functionality.
Cleaning Options
Self-cleaning modes and easy-to-clean interiors make upkeep simpler.
Style Compatibility
Pick an oven that fits your style visual and matches existing kitchen cabinetry.
